标记染料,一种新型的125I-吲哚单碳菁染料和125I-溴磺酚酞,用于大鼠实验性胆汁淤积和脂肪变性的研究。

Labelled dyes, a new 125I-indomonocarbocyanine and 125I-BSP, in the exploration of experimental cholestasis and steatosis in the rat.

作者信息

Lapalus F, Moreau M F, Meyniel G

出版信息

Br J Exp Pathol. 1981 Feb;62(1):13-21.

PMID:7225289
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C2041635/
Abstract

A new dye, an indomonocarbocyanine labelled with radioactive iodine, was studied in normal rats and in rats with experimental diseases. After i.v. injection, the cyanine was selectively concentrated in the liver and eliminated in the bile; urinary excretion was found to be minimal but increased in rats with ligated bile duct. In addition, the blood clearance kinetics of the labelled dyes were significantly modified in cases of hepatic cholestasis or steatosis. A comparative study was carried out with 125I-BSP; the results showed that these 2 dyes may be considered as complementary in the exploration of liver function.

摘要

一种新的染料,一种用放射性碘标记的吲哚单碳菁染料,在正常大鼠和患有实验性疾病的大鼠身上进行了研究。静脉注射后,该菁染料选择性地集中在肝脏并经胆汁排出;发现尿液排泄极少,但在胆管结扎的大鼠中有所增加。此外,在肝内胆汁淤积或脂肪变性的情况下,标记染料的血液清除动力学有显著改变。用125I-磺溴酞钠进行了一项对比研究;结果表明,这两种染料在肝功能检查中可被视为互补。
